Université de Montréal, Montreal, Canada
The Université de Montréal’s Faculty of Arts and Science is seeking an Assistant Professor of Research-Creation in Visual Arts to join the Department of Art History, Cinema and Audiovisual Media. This role will contribute to an innovative teaching and research environment, emphasizing visual arts and research-creation within Quebec’s cultural landscape.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and lead a research program in visual arts and research-creation.
- Teach across undergraduate and graduate levels, supervise students, and engage in departmental activities.
- Contribute to the academic life and reputation of the faculty through committee work, conferences, publications, and exhibitions.
- Foster collaborations with arts institutions and galleries.
Qualifications:
- PhD (or nearing completion) in visual arts, art history, or a related field.
- Strong record of publications and ongoing artistic practice with recognition in the field.
- Demonstrated university teaching experience and student supervision.
- Commitment to achieving proficiency in French, supported by language assistance if needed.
